Latvian hopes awash with Russian money from Cyprus

The influential British business newspaper The Financial Times reports that amid the rush from rival banking nations to attract Russian cash stuck on the stricken island of Cyprus, one name stood out: Latvia. Cypriot lawyers with Russian customers say Latvian banks contacted them within hours of the announcement of a bailout for the Mediterranean island, writes LETA.
